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Puerto Real, Spain

While not as internationally famous as some of its neighbours, Puerto Real boasts a captivating collection of sights and experiences.

  • Castillo de San Luis de los Franceses: Explore the imposing remains of this historic castle, a testament to the region's rich past. Imagine the stories its weathered stones could tell!
  • Playa de la Calita: Relax on the golden sands of this beautiful beach, perfect for soaking up the sun and enjoying the refreshing Atlantic waters.
  • Iglesia Mayor Prioral de San Sebastián: Admire the architectural beauty of this grand church, a significant landmark in the heart of the town.
  • Paseo Marítimo: Stroll along the picturesque promenade, enjoying breathtaking views of the bay and the lively atmosphere.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Puerto Real, Spain

Puerto Real's culinary scene is a delightful mix of traditional Andalusian dishes and fresh seafood. Don't miss the opportunity to sample:

  • Fresh seafood paella: A classic Spanish dish made with locally caught seafood.
  • Gazpacho: A refreshing cold tomato soup, perfect for a hot day.
  • Pescaíto frito: Deep-fried small fish, a local specialty.
  • Local wines: Sample the region's delicious wines, perfectly complementing the seafood dishes.

When’s the Best Time to Go?

The best time to visit Puerto Real is during the sh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) for pleasant weather and fewer crowds. Summer can be hot, while winter can be mild but with occasional rain.

Transportation Options in Puerto Real, Spain

Puerto Real is easily walkable, especially the old town and port areas. Local buses provide convenient transportation to other parts of the town and surrounding areas.
